Jikha
Jikha is a village in Samegrelo and Zemo Svaneti, Georgia and has about 249 residents. Jikha is situated nearby to the village Gakhomela, as well as near Lebaghadule.| Tap on a place to explore it |

Archaeopolis
Photo: Lika2672, Public domain.
Nokalakevi also known as Archaeopolis and Tsikhegoji and according to some sources "Djikha Kvinji" in Mingrelian, is a village and archaeological site in the Senaki municipality, Samegrelo-Zemo Svaneti region, Georgia.

Bandza
Village
Photo: Nanadanelia, CC BY-SA 4.0.
Bandza is a village located in the west part of Georgia, Martvili municipality. It consists of three small villages: Levakhane, Lekekele, Lepatarave. Bandza is situated on Odishi-Guria plain, on the left side of the river Abasha. Bandza is situated 6 km east of Jikha.
Vedidkari
Village
Vedidkari is a village in Samegrelo-Zemo Svaneti province of Western Georgia. The village is located in 15 kilometers from Martvili. According to the data of 2014, 713 people live in the village of Vedidkari. Vedidkari is situated 6 km southeast of Jikha.
